DiamondShield Coatings

Morgan Advanced Materials makes Diamondshield coatings for plastics and polymers used on consumer and portable electronic devices.

When applied to plastics via chemical vapour deposition (CVD), this water-clear coating increases surface hardness to that of glass, providing enhanced durability and better abrasion-resistance and wear-resistance.

Our Diamondshield coating is used to make portable electronic devices more robust by strengthening the surface hardness of plastic parts so that they are more resistant to scratching. This increased durability leads to an extended product lifespan; there is less wear on keypads and push buttons and screens maintain better clarity over time, making them easier to read. The transparent coating has a low refraction index and virtually no absorption in the visible wavelengths.

Multiphase Coatings

We are now offering a range of coatings for our ceramic products to enhance the electrical performance in distinguished applications.

The single phase coatings (green) are excellent for supressing the emission of secondary electrons, which reduces surface charging effects.

The multi-phase coatings (black) produce a conductive ceramic surface that enables operation of power tubes at very high voltages. The flexibility of these coatings means that surface resistivity can be tailored between 109 > 1014. These coatings are also excellent for enabling size reduction which lowers weight and hence TCO of our customers systems.
